About the Role:

As a seasonal entry-level Environmental Technician, you will support environmental field investigations and hazardous materials assessments under the guidance of senior staff. This entry-level role involves hands-on fieldwork, including sampling of various environmental media, and assisting with data collection and reporting. You will also be responsible for maintaining and calibrating field equipment, ensuring it is clean and operational. This position offers a valuable opportunity to gain foundational experience in environmental science while contributing to meaningful environmental protection and compliance efforts.



  • Field Sampling: Collect soil, groundwater, surface water, and sediment samples following standard procedures.
  • Environmental Surveys: Assist with wetland delineations, stream classifications, and identification of local plants and animals.
  • Equipment Maintenance: Clean, maintain, and calibrate field equipment to ensure accurate data collection.
  • Data Support: Record field observations and assist with basic reporting and data entry under supervision.
